Transaction ffd862fdbfbde72c43fc178b1961a66cb171d6839e2676b28cf96c5a3a3d08fe

3 Input
2 Outputs
  • ffd862fdbfbde72c43fc178b1961a66cb171d6839e2676b28cf96c5a3a3d08fe:0
  • value  842776
    address  1PEKNmC8EoS6PJpKhKRS2uzFdn7tTYEaTc
  • ffd862fdbfbde72c43fc178b1961a66cb171d6839e2676b28cf96c5a3a3d08fe:1
  • value  10000000
    address  1EkzhxTavAgNwSbX5tK6zwjgXYJgmBfg2b